Yes, about 8 pieces in total all with similar patterns. They look like the same style of pottery that was found in the Bottle Creek Mound in the Delta of Mobile. I am guessing they come from the same period. This years storms have revealed a rash of pottery and arrowheads all along the eastern shore of Mobile Bay. I have seen several finds from different people.
The oyster shell bits are supposed to help heat the clay evenly when they are fired in the ovens...seems the oyster shells will heat up hotter than the clay and hold the heat...kinda like an ancient micro wave.
